Neck Incision to Remove an Object in the Food Pipe

Indiana rates for HCPCS 43020

Opens the food pipe through an incision in the neck to take out a swallowed object lodged in its upper part, then closes the opening. It is used when the object cannot be retrieved with a scope passed through the mouth, or when it is sharp or has become stuck in the wall. A drain is often left beside the repair while it heals.
